Description
2.4663 (VdTÜV 485) is a nickel-chromium-molybdenum alloy with outstanding corrosion resistance, particularly in aggressive environments such as oxidizing and reducing media, as well as in chloride-rich and acidic conditions. This material is widely used in chemical processing, offshore technology, and power generation industries for critical components like heat exchangers, reactors, piping systems, and pressure vessels. Known for its high mechanical strength, excellent thermal stability, and resistance to stress corrosion cracking, 2.4663 performs reliably under extreme operating conditions.
